Pharmacological studies of sulphadiazine on Clarias gariepinu fish infected with Aeromonas hydrophila
|
|
Abstract |
Pharmacokinetics, efficacy and tissue residues of sulphadiazine (SDZ) were studied in Clarias gariepinus experimentally infected with Aeromonas hydrophila. Following experimental infection and appearance of clinical symptoms which were mostly signs of septicemia, fish were given sulphadiazine orally (100 mg/kg body weight).
The obtained results showed that sulphadiazine was effective for treatment of Aeromonas hydrophila infection in Clarias gariepinus Pharmacokinetic and statistical analysis were performed. The absorption half life (t 0. 5 el) were significantly shorter. Sulphadiazine was detected in tissues of healthy and infected fish after daily dosing of 100 mg/kg. body weight for five days.
